The cricketing world was set ablaze as South Africa’s Heinrich Klaasen delivered a spectacular performance in the 4th One Day International (ODI) against Australia. The match, held at SuperSport Park, Centurion, ended with a resounding victory for the home team.
South Africa took to the pitch with an air of determination that was palpable from the onset. Their batting prowess stood out throughout their innings as they posted an imposing total score of 416/5. This feat was largely thanks to Heinrich Klaasen’s fiery ton which left spectators and players alike in awe 🏏.
Klaasen’s exceptional skills were on full display during this match. His century came off just 69 balls – an impressive strike rate by any standard. With each boundary he hit, you could hear the roar from his teammates and fans growing louder and louder.
